Skip to content

Commit 6f4352d

Browse files
reebhubmateuszbartosik
authored andcommitted
Edited AI integration start page
1 parent 16dfe01 commit 6f4352d

File tree

4 files changed

+53
-75
lines changed

4 files changed

+53
-75
lines changed

docs/ai-integration/ai-agents/ai-agents_start.mdx

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-24,8 +24,7 @@ AI agents are server-side components that act as secure proxies between RavenDB
2424
- [See common AI agents use cases](../../ai-integration/ai-agents/ai-agents_start#use-cases)
2525

2626
## Technical documentation
27-
Our technical documentation explains in detail what AI agents are and how to define and use them.
28-
If you're new to AI agents, we recommend the [overview](../../ai-integration/ai-agents/ai-agents_overview) page as a good starting point.
27+
Use the technical documentation to learn how to create and manage AI agents, configure secure database access, enable agents to trigger client actions, and more.
2928

3029
<ColGrid colCount={3}>
3130
<CardWithImage title="AI Agents Overview" description="Basic concepts of RavenDB's native AI agents" url="../../ai-integration/ai-agents/ai-agents_overview" imgSrc={aiAgentsStartOvImage} imgAlt="imgAlt" ctaLabel="Read" />
Lines changed: 52 additions & 73 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
---
2-
title: "AI Integration: Start"
2+
title: "AI Integration"
33
hide_table_of_contents: true
44
sidebar_label: "Start"
55
sidebar_position: 0
@@ -14,104 +14,83 @@ import embedGenStartImage from "./assets/ai-start_embeddings-generation_light.pn
1414
import vectorSearchStartImage from "./assets/ai-start_vector-search_light.png";
1515
import genAiStartImage from "./assets/ai-start_gen-ai_light.png";
1616
import aiAgentsStartImage from "./assets/ai-start_ai-agents_light.png";
17-
17+
import buildVsBuyStartImage from "./assets/ai-start_ai-agents_build-vs-buy.png";
18+
import vectorSearchIntroImage from "./assets/ai-start_vector-search_intro.png";
1819

1920
# AI Integration
20-
### Use native AI features to create intelligent database applications.
21+
Ship AI-powered features faster with RavenDB’s native tools.
2122

23+
### Native AI features that create intelligent applications
2224
RavenDB is equipped with a set of powerful native AI features that can
2325
be used independently or in conjunction with each other, allowing you to easily integrate advanced AI capabilities into your applications.
2426
These features include [AI agents](../ai-integration/ai-integration_start#ai-agents), [GenAI tasks](../ai-integration/ai-integration_start#genai-tasks), [Embeddings generation](../ai-integration/ai-integration_start#embeddings-generation), and [Vector search](../ai-integration/ai-integration_start#vector-search).
2527

26-
<br />
28+
### Use cases
29+
RavenDB AI features help you ship any AI-related scenario quickly, including:
30+
* [Conversational intelligence](../ai-integration/ai-agents/ai-agents_start#use-cases) - Natural-language chatbots, assistants, and interactive workflows.
31+
* [Automated content enrichment](../ai-integration/gen-ai-integration/gen-ai_start#use-cases) - Summarization, translation, classification, and document enhancement.
32+
* [Semantic representation](../ai-integration/generating-embeddings/embeddings-generation_start#use-cases) - Creating vector representations for text, images, and other data types.
33+
* [Similarity-based discovery](../ai-integration/vector-search/vector-search_start#use-cases) - Finding related items, aggregation, and context-aware retrieval.
34+
* [Personalization & recommendations](../ai-integration/vector-search/vector-search_start#use-cases) - Tailoring suggestions, feeds, and user experiences.
35+
* [Content moderation & compliance](../ai-integration/gen-ai-integration/gen-ai_start#use-cases) - Automatically handling sensitive, inappropriate, or non-compliant content.
36+
* [Knowledge management & Q&A](../ai-integration/ai-agents/ai-agents_start#use-cases) - Asking questions over policies, wikis, and documents; retrieving answers and citations.
37+
38+
Learn More: In-Depth AI Feature Articles
39+
<ColGrid colCount={2}>
40+
<CardWithImage title="RavenDB GenAI Deep Dive" description="A deep-dive with hands-on examples and implementation details, by Oren Eini" imgSrc="" url="https://ravendb.net/articles/ravendb-genai-deep-dive" imgAlt="imgAlt" ctaLabel="Read" />
41+
<CardWithImage title="Practical Look at AI Agents with RavenDB" description="A step-by-step tutorial for building AI agents with RavenDB, by Gracjan Sadowicz" imgSrc="" url="https://ravendb.net/articles/practical-look-at-ai-agents-with-ravendb" imgAlt="imgAlt" ctaLabel="Read" />
42+
</ColGrid>
2743

2844
### AI agents
29-
3045
AI agents are conversational proxy components that reside on the server and autonomously handle client requests using an AI model. Instead of spending your time on integrating AI capabilities into your application, you can rapidly configure AI agents using Studio or the client API. Agents can securely read from the database and request the client for actions on behalf of the AI model, infusing intelligence into the workflow. Whether you need chatbots, automated reporting, or intelligent data processing, you get immediate production-ready AI features without the integration overhead.
3146

32-
<Admonition type="note" title="">
33-
[See common AI agents use cases](../ai-integration/ai-agents/ai-agents_start#use-cases)
34-
</Admonition>
35-
36-
<Admonition type="note" title="">
37-
<ColGrid colCount={3}>
38-
<CardWithImage title="Start page" description="Continue to the AI agents Start page" url="../ai-integration/ai-agents/ai-agents_start" imgSrc={aiAgentsStartImage} imgAlt="imgAlt" ctaLabel="Read" />
39-
<CardWithImage title="Technical documentation" description="Enter the AI agents technical documentation" url="../ai-integration/ai-agents/ai-agents_start#technical-documentation" imgSrc={aiAgentsStartImage} imgAlt="imgAlt" ctaLabel="Read" />
40-
<CardWithImage title="In-depth articles" description="Read in-depth article about AI agents" url="../ai-integration/ai-agents/ai-agents_start#in-depth-articles" imgSrc={aiAgentsStartImage} imgAlt="imgAlt" ctaLabel="Read" />
41-
</ColGrid>
42-
</Admonition>
43-
44-
<Admonition type="note" title="">
45-
<ColGrid colCount={1}>
46-
<CardWithImageHorizontal title="How to run AI agents natively in your database" description="Watch a webinar about AI agents" url="https://www.youtube.com/watch?v=A17GSLGN-cQ" imgSrc="https://media.licdn.com/dms/image/v2/D4D10AQG81cXtiYRc2w/image-shrink_800/B4DZZYYLcTHwAk-/0/1745239456036?e=2147483647&v=beta&t=yQVz6ji4wD4reOTXtlPpERK0fdpr1f2VoG_SEV9x3lc" imgAlt="imgAlt" ctaLabel="Watch" />
47+
<ColGrid colCount={2}>
48+
<CardWithImage title="AI agents Start page" description="Continue to the AI agents Start page." url="../ai-integration/ai-agents/ai-agents_start" imgSrc={aiAgentsStartImage} imgAlt="imgAlt" ctaLabel="Read" />
49+
<CardWithImage title="Technical documentation" description="Learn how to create, deploy, manage conversations, and get results with AI agents." url="../ai-integration/ai-agents/ai-agents_start#technical-documentation" imgSrc={aiAgentsStartImage} imgAlt="imgAlt" ctaLabel="Read" />
4750
</ColGrid>
48-
</Admonition>
49-
50-
<br />
5151

5252
### GenAI tasks
5353
GenAI tasks are configurable [ongoing operations](../studio/database/tasks/ongoing-tasks/general-info) that process your documents systematically in the background using an AI model. Instead of building custom AI integration pipelines yourself, you can easily create tasks that weave AI capabilities into your data flow. They can enrich documents with AI-generated content, validate and categorize data, translate documents, or execute countless other automated workflows that leverage AI capabilities.
5454

55-
<Admonition type="note" title="">
56-
[See common GenAI tasks use cases](../ai-integration/gen-ai-integration/gen-ai_start#use-cases)
57-
</Admonition>
58-
59-
<Admonition type="note" title="">
60-
<ColGrid colCount={3}>
61-
<CardWithImage title="Start page" description="Continue to the GenAI tasks Start page" url="../ai-integration/gen-ai-integration/gen-ai_start" imgSrc={genAiStartImage} imgAlt="imgAlt" ctaLabel="Read" />
62-
<CardWithImage title="Technical documentation" description="Enter the GenAI tasks technical documentation" url="../ai-integration/gen-ai-integration/gen-ai_start#technical-documentation" imgSrc={genAiStartImage} imgAlt="imgAlt" ctaLabel="Read" />
63-
<CardWithImage title="In-depth articles" description="Read in-depth articles about GenAI" url="../ai-integration/gen-ai-integration/gen-ai_start#in-depth-articles" imgSrc={genAiStartImage} imgAlt="imgAlt" ctaLabel="Read" />
55+
<ColGrid colCount={2}>
56+
<CardWithImage title="GenAI tasks Start page" description="Continue to the GenAI tasks Start page." url="../ai-integration/gen-ai-integration/gen-ai_start" imgSrc={genAiStartImage} imgAlt="imgAlt" ctaLabel="Read" />
57+
<CardWithImage title="Technical documentation" description="Learn to create GenAI tasks that process your data and enable intelligent workflows automation." url="../ai-integration/gen-ai-integration/gen-ai_start#technical-documentation" imgSrc={genAiStartImage} imgAlt="imgAlt" ctaLabel="Read" />
6458
</ColGrid>
65-
</Admonition>
6659

67-
<Admonition type="note" title="">
68-
<ColGrid colCount={1}>
69-
<CardWithImageHorizontal title="Why are GenAI tasks so effective" description="Watch a webinar about GenAI tasks" url="https://www.youtube.com/watch?v=NgvyeHwwVjM" imgSrc="https://media.licdn.com/dms/image/v2/D4D10AQG81cXtiYRc2w/image-shrink_800/B4DZZYYLcTHwAk-/0/1745239456036?e=2147483647&v=beta&t=yQVz6ji4wD4reOTXtlPpERK0fdpr1f2VoG_SEV9x3lc" imgAlt="imgAlt" ctaLabel="Watch" />
60+
### Embeddings generation
61+
Embeddings generation tasks transform your content into semantic vectors that enable intelligent similarity-based searches. Instead of building complex search infrastructure, you can utilize native tasks that seamlessly embed vector capabilities into your data, enabling intelligent search by meaning and context.
62+
63+
<ColGrid colCount={2}>
64+
<CardWithImage title="Embeddings generation Start page" description="Continue to the embeddings generation Start page." url="../ai-integration/generating-embeddings/embeddings-generation_start" imgSrc={embedGenStartImage} imgAlt="imgAlt" ctaLabel="Read" />
65+
<CardWithImage title="Technical documentation" description="Learn to generate embeddings and enable intelligent searches." url="../ai-integration/generating-embeddings/embeddings-generation_start#technical-documentation" imgSrc={embedGenStartImage} imgAlt="imgAlt" ctaLabel="Read" />
7066
</ColGrid>
71-
</Admonition>
7267

73-
<br />
68+
### Vector search
69+
Vector search enables intelligent similarity-based discovery using embeddings rather than exact matching. Instead of developing custom similarity algorithms yourself, you can employ native vector operations for diverse applications. Whether you need to categorize content, find similar items, or automate recommendations, vector search delivers intelligent matching capabilities that understand meaning and context.
7470

75-
### Embeddings generation
76-
Embeddings generation tasks transform your content into semantic vectors that enable intelligent similarity-based searches. Instead of building complex search infrastructure, you can leverage native tasks that seamlessly embed vector capabilities into your data, enabling intelligent search by meaning and context.
71+
<ColGrid colCount={2}>
72+
<CardWithImage title="Vector search Start page" description="Continue to the vector search Start page." url="../ai-integration/vector-search/vector-search_start" imgSrc={vectorSearchStartImage} imgAlt="imgAlt" ctaLabel="Read" />
73+
<CardWithImage title="Technical documentation" description="Learn to search your data by meaning and context." url="../ai-integration/vector-search/vector-search_start#technical-documentation" imgSrc={vectorSearchStartImage} imgAlt="imgAlt" ctaLabel="Read" />
74+
</ColGrid>
7775

78-
<Admonition type="note" title="">
79-
[See common embeddings-generation use cases](../ai-integration/generating-embeddings/embeddings-generation_start#use-cases)
80-
</Admonition>
76+
### Lives & Videos
77+
Watch our broadcasts to see RavenDB's AI features in action and learn practical implementation techniques.
8178

82-
<Admonition type="note" title="">
83-
<ColGrid colCount={3}>
84-
<CardWithImage title="Start page" description="Continue to the embeddings generation Start page" url="../ai-integration/generating-embeddings/embeddings-generation_start" imgSrc={embedGenStartImage} imgAlt="imgAlt" ctaLabel="Read" />
85-
<CardWithImage title="Technical documentation" description="Enter the embeddings generation technical documentation" url="../ai-integration/generating-embeddings/embeddings-generation_start#technical-documentation" imgSrc={embedGenStartImage} imgAlt="imgAlt" ctaLabel="Read" />
86-
<CardWithImage title="In-depth articles" description="Read in-depth articles about embeddings generation" url="../ai-integration/generating-embeddings/embeddings-generation_start#in-depth-articles" imgSrc={embedGenStartImage} imgAlt="imgAlt" ctaLabel="Read" />
79+
<ColGrid colCount={1}>
80+
<CardWithImageHorizontal title="How to run AI agents natively in your database" description="Watch a webinar about AI agents." url="https://www.youtube.com/watch?v=A17GSLGN-cQ" imgSrc="https://media.licdn.com/dms/image/v2/D4D10AQG81cXtiYRc2w/image-shrink_800/B4DZZYYLcTHwAk-/0/1745239456036?e=2147483647&v=beta&t=yQVz6ji4wD4reOTXtlPpERK0fdpr1f2VoG_SEV9x3lc" imgAlt="imgAlt" ctaLabel="Watch" />
8781
</ColGrid>
88-
</Admonition>
89-
90-
<Admonition type="note" title="">
9182
<ColGrid colCount={1}>
92-
<CardWithImageHorizontal title="Vector search in RavenDB" description="Watch a webinar about Embeddings generation" url="https://www.youtube.com/watch?v=zZwid8LA-e4" imgSrc="https://media.licdn.com/dms/image/v2/D4D10AQG81cXtiYRc2w/image-shrink_800/B4DZZYYLcTHwAk-/0/1745239456036?e=2147483647&v=beta&t=yQVz6ji4wD4reOTXtlPpERK0fdpr1f2VoG_SEV9x3lc" imgAlt="imgAlt" ctaLabel="Watch" />
83+
<CardWithImageHorizontal title="Why are GenAI tasks so effective" description="Watch a webinar about GenAI tasks." url="https://www.youtube.com/watch?v=NgvyeHwwVjM" imgSrc="https://media.licdn.com/dms/image/v2/D4D10AQG81cXtiYRc2w/image-shrink_800/B4DZZYYLcTHwAk-/0/1745239456036?e=2147483647&v=beta&t=yQVz6ji4wD4reOTXtlPpERK0fdpr1f2VoG_SEV9x3lc" imgAlt="imgAlt" ctaLabel="Watch" />
84+
</ColGrid>
85+
<ColGrid colCount={1}>
86+
<CardWithImageHorizontal title="Take over the world with AI and RavenDB" description="Watch a webinar about vector search." url="https://www.youtube.com/watch?v=7DhbgfH_rSE" imgSrc="https://media.licdn.com/dms/image/v2/D4D10AQG81cXtiYRc2w/image-shrink_800/B4DZZYYLcTHwAk-/0/1745239456036?e=2147483647&v=beta&t=yQVz6ji4wD4reOTXtlPpERK0fdpr1f2VoG_SEV9x3lc" imgAlt="imgAlt" ctaLabel="Watch" />
9387
</ColGrid>
94-
</Admonition>
95-
96-
<br />
97-
98-
### Vector search
99-
Vector search enables intelligent similarity-based discovery using embeddings rather than exact matching. Instead of developing custom similarity algorithms yourself, you can leverage native vector operations for diverse applications. Whether you need to categorize content, find similar items, or automate recommendations, vector search delivers intelligent matching capabilities that understand meaning and context.
10088

101-
<Admonition type="note" title="">
102-
[See common vector search use cases](../ai-integration/vector-search/vector-search_start#use-cases)
103-
</Admonition>
89+
### Deep dives, content & resources
90+
Find additional resources to enhance your knowledge and skills.
10491

105-
<Admonition type="note" title="">
10692
<ColGrid colCount={3}>
107-
<CardWithImage title="Start page" description="Continue to the vector search Start page" url="../ai-integration/vector-search/vector-search_start" imgSrc={vectorSearchStartImage} imgAlt="imgAlt" ctaLabel="Read" />
108-
<CardWithImage title="Technical documentation" description="Enter the vector search technical documentation" url="../ai-integration/vector-search/vector-search_start#technical-documentation" imgSrc={vectorSearchStartImage} imgAlt="imgAlt" ctaLabel="Read" />
109-
<CardWithImage title="In-depth articles" description="Read in-depth articles about vector search" url="../ai-integration/vector-search/vector-search_start#in-depth-articles" imgSrc={vectorSearchStartImage} imgAlt="imgAlt" ctaLabel="Read" />
110-
</ColGrid>
111-
</Admonition>
112-
113-
<Admonition type="note" title="">
114-
<ColGrid colCount={1}>
115-
<CardWithImageHorizontal title="Take over the world with AI and RavenDB" description="Watch a webinar about vector search" url="https://www.youtube.com/watch?v=7DhbgfH_rSE" imgSrc="https://media.licdn.com/dms/image/v2/D4D10AQG81cXtiYRc2w/image-shrink_800/B4DZZYYLcTHwAk-/0/1745239456036?e=2147483647&v=beta&t=yQVz6ji4wD4reOTXtlPpERK0fdpr1f2VoG_SEV9x3lc" imgAlt="imgAlt" ctaLabel="Watch" />
116-
</ColGrid>
117-
</Admonition>
93+
<CardWithImage title="Build vs. Buy" description="The difference between building an AI agent infrastructure from scratch and using RavenDB's native AI agents" imgSrc={buildVsBuyStartImage} url="https://ravendb.net/articles/build-vs-buy-the-real-cost-of-adding-ai-agents-to-your-application" imgAlt="imgAlt" ctaLabel="Read now" />
94+
<CardWithImage title="Introduction to vector search" description="A glimpse of what can be achieved with vector search" url="https://ravendb.net/articles/new-in-7-0-ravendbs-vector-search" imgSrc={vectorSearchIntroImage} imgAlt="imgAlt" ctaLabel="Read now" />
95+
<CardWithImage title="Future-proof your tech stack" description="Where Does GenAI Truly Fit" imgSrc={genAiStartImage} url="https://www.youtube.com/watch?v=OjEAWHGKyJY" imgIcon="gen-ai" imgAlt="imgAlt" ctaLabel="Read now" />
96+
</ColGrid>
91.9 KB
Loading
107 KB
Loading

0 commit comments

Comments
 (0)